Properties Comparison

Property EN8 Steel Properties BS970 080M40 Equivalent Material Tensile Yield Strength SAE AISI 4140 Steel Properties, Material Heat Treatment, Rockwell Hardness
Metal Base Steel Steel
Tensile Strength 550.0 MPa 1020.0 MPa
Yield Strength 280.0 MPa 655.0 MPa
Elongation 16.0 % 17.7 %
Hardness (Brinell) 152.0 HB 302.0 HB
